Catherine Louise “Katty” Helmick Hinkle

obit Catharine HinkleCatherine Louise “Katty” Helmick Hinkle, age 79 years, a resident of Hambleton, departed this life Tuesday morning, August 27, 2013 at her home surrounded by her family.
She was born Friday, September 1, 1933 at Hambleton,  a daughter of the late Myles Pleasant Helmick and Georgia Ann Delaney Helmick.  On February 11, 1950 at Red House, Md., she was married to Richard Allen “Dick” Hinkle, Sr., who preceded her in death May 6, 1999.  They had celebrated forty nine years of marriage.
Surviving are one son, Richard Allen Hinkle, Jr. of Hillsboro; four daughters, Evelyn Louise Cassidy and husband Phil of Hambleton, Mary Lee Isaacson and husband Todd, Phyllis “Ann” Kerns and husband Archie and Kathy Margarette Dumire and husband Jerry, all of Parsons; one aunt, Catherine Helmick Shephard of Ridgeley,  twenty grandchildren, twenty great grandchildren and several nieces and nephews.
She is the last surviving member of her immediate family having been preceded in death by one son, James Anthony “Tony” Arman; two daughters, Vivian Anna Hinkle and Roberta Ellen Hinkle; three brothers, Myles Junior Helmick, William Ashley Helmick and Theodore ValJean “Snuffy” Helmick; one sister, Mary Lee Burruss and one great grandson, Andrew Kelley Cassidy.
She attended the one room schools at Fork Mountain and Hambleton; and the Hamrick School.  She was an employee of the former Nella’s Nursing Home at White Gables, the Parsons Nursery, the former Dorman Mills, Kingsford Charcoal Company and she was a cook for eighteen years for the Tucker County Schools.  She was a member of the Hambleton United Methodist Church.  She enjoyed cooking, gardening, sewing and embroidery.
The family will receive friends at the Lohr & Barb Funeral Home of Parsons on Friday from 4 to 8 p.m.    Final rites will be conducted at the funeral home parlor on Saturday, August 31, 2013 at 1 p.m.   Pastor Loren Metzner will officiate and interment will follow at the Sunrise Cemetery at Hambleton.
